Event Details
 Occultation UUID [and DB] : 2c51f910-85b1-11ef-78cd-9db7ff7f7896 [asteroids]

 Occultation Date + Time   : 2025-07-31 at 20:08:34 UT +/- 0.0 min  [1]
 Object Designation        : (442) Eichsfeldia
 Orbit Class               : MBA
 Star Designation          : GDR3 3637114959228032896
 Star Coordinates (ICRF)   : RA = 13 31 32.1061, DE = -03 12 51.964  [2]
 Star Magnitudes           : G = 13.25 mag, RP = 12.53 mag, BP = 13.8 mag
 Object Magnitude          : V = 14.61 mag
 Estimated Magnitude Drop  : 1.6 mag
 Estimated Max. Duration   : 2.4 sec
 Object Mean Diameter      : 65.7 km  (src: astorb)
 Speed of the shadow       : 27.2 km/s
 Elongation to Moon & Sun  : 13° (sunlit = 44%), Sun = 74°
 Cross-track uncertainty   : 0.8 mas = 1 km = 0.02 path-width (1-sig)
 RUWE and duplicate source : 4.75 mas, dup.src = 0  (0:false, 1:true)

 Ephemeris Reference       : JPL#72

 
 [1] time t0 of closest geocentric approach c/a, [2] including proper motion until t0
